summaryrefslogtreecommitdiff
path: root/eclass
Commit message (Collapse)AuthorAgeFilesLines
* linux-mod.eclass: add bugref for Modules.symversIonen Wolkens2022-12-281-1/+1
| | | | | | In case someone would re-add the || die without looking into this.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* linux-mod.eclass: revert adding || die for Modules.symversIonen Wolkens2022-12-281-1/+1
| | | | | | | | | Emergency fix given this apparently broke potentially several packages, at least e.g. virtualbox-modules, and zenpower3 from guru. Fixes: bc0ef44947363a33b5cd9b18bcc0d3c32b808311 Closes: https://bugs.gentoo.org/888679 Signed-off-by: Ionen Wolkens <ionen@gentoo.org>
* acct-group.eclass: Don't modify groups when EPREFIX is non-emptyJames Le Cuirot2022-12-271-1/+1
| | | | | | | | This was happening when running a prefix as root, which we don't really support, but also when building a prefixed system under ROOT. Closes: https://bugs.gentoo.org/779181 Signed-off-by: James Le Cuirot <chewi@gentoo.org>
* llvm.org.eclass: Add experimental Xtensa target to 16.xMichał Górny2022-12-271-1/+10
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* xorg-3.eclass: remove useless || die on emakeDavid Seifert2022-12-271-4/+4
| | | | | | Signed-off-by: David Seifert <soap@gentoo.org> Closes: https://github.com/gentoo/gentoo/pull/28787 Signed-off-by: David Seifert <soap@gentoo.org>
* qmail.eclass: remove useless || die on emakeDavid Seifert2022-12-271-2/+2
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* gnustep-base.eclass: remove useless || die on emakeDavid Seifert2022-12-271-4/+4
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* gnome2.eclass: remove useless || die on emakeDavid Seifert2022-12-271-2/+2
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* xemacs-packages.eclass: drop EAPI 6, 7 supportDavid Seifert2022-12-271-4/+4
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* waf-utils.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-6/+13
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* usr-ldscript.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-18/+20
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* user-info.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-2/+2
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* toolchain-autoconf.eclass: drop EAPI 6, add EAPI 8 supportDavid Seifert2022-12-271-14/+8
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* selinux-policy-2.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-24/+25
| | | | | Closes: https://bugs.gentoo.org/778812 Signed-off-by: David Seifert <soap@gentoo.org>
* rust-toolchain.eclass: drop EAPI 6, 7 supportDavid Seifert2022-12-271-5/+3
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* ruby-single.eclass: drop EAPI 4-6 supportDavid Seifert2022-12-271-13/+6
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* ruby-ng-gnome2.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-8/+10
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* rocm.eclass: drop EAPI 7 supportDavid Seifert2022-12-271-5/+5
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* python-utils-r1.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-31/+14
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* python-single-r1.eclass: drop EAPI 6 supportDavid Seifert2022-12-276-27/+17
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* python-r1.eclass: drop EAPI 6 supportDavid Seifert2022-12-277-25/+14
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* python-any-r1.eclass: drop EAPI 6 supportDavid Seifert2022-12-276-20/+15
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* postgres-multi.eclass: drop EAPI 5, 6 supportDavid Seifert2022-12-271-19/+19
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* postgres.eclass: drop EAPI 5, 6 supportDavid Seifert2022-12-271-7/+11
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* php-ext-source-r3.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-12/+13
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* php-ext-pecl-r3.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-3/+3
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* ninja-utils.eclass: drop EAPI 5, 6 supportDavid Seifert2022-12-271-8/+5
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* mozlinguas-v2.eclass: drop EAPI 6, 7 supportDavid Seifert2022-12-271-12/+13
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* mozextension.eclass: drop EAPI 0-7 supportDavid Seifert2022-12-271-6/+11
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* mozcoreconf-v6.eclass: drop EAPI 6, 7 supportDavid Seifert2022-12-271-16/+9
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* llvm.eclass: canonicalize eclass structureDavid Seifert2022-12-271-4/+4
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* linux-mod.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-17/+9
| | | | | | * eutils.eclass functionality was not used in EAPI 7. Signed-off-by: David Seifert <soap@gentoo.org>
* libretro-core.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-10/+9
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* java-virtuals-2.eclass: drop EAPI 5-7 supportDavid Seifert2022-12-271-3/+3
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* java-osgi.eclass: drop EAPI 5, 6 supportDavid Seifert2022-12-271-9/+6
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* fcaps.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-6/+6
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* dune.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-25/+29
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* dotnet.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-11/+10
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* docs.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-17/+7
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* bazel.eclass: drop EAPI 7 supportDavid Seifert2022-12-271-11/+5
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* aspell-dict-r1.eclass: drop EAPI 7 supportDavid Seifert2022-12-271-12/+9
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* apache-2.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-13/+12
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* ant-tasks.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-12/+5
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* alternatives.eclass: drop EAPI 5, 6 supportDavid Seifert2022-12-271-8/+7
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* ada.eclass: drop EAPI 6 supportDavid Seifert2022-12-271-11/+4
| | | | Signed-off-by: David Seifert <soap@gentoo.org>
* kernel-2.eclass: minor whitespace fixesSam James2022-12-271-16/+16
| | | | | Signed-off-by: Sam James <sam@gentoo.org> Signed-off-by: David Seifert <soap@gentoo.org>
* linux-info.eclass: use consistent styleSam James2022-12-271-76/+66
| | | | | | | | | - Use Bash tests (i.e. [[ ]] instead of [ ]) - Use consistent newlines for if/while - Drop unnecessary ; line terminators Signed-off-by: Sam James <sam@gentoo.org> Signed-off-by: David Seifert <soap@gentoo.org>
* linux-mod.eclass: use consistent styleSam James2022-12-271-86/+64
| | | | | | | | | | - Use Bash tests (i.e. [[ ]] instead of [ ]) - Use consistent newlines for if/while - Drop unnecessary ; line terminators - Add a handful of missing || dies Signed-off-by: Sam James <sam@gentoo.org> Signed-off-by: David Seifert <soap@gentoo.org>
* llvm.org.eclass: Add 16.0.0_pre20221226 snapshotMichał Górny2022-12-271-0/+3
| | | | Signed-off-by: Michał Górny <mgorny@gentoo.org>
* eclass/apache-2.eclass: update maintainerHans de Graaff2022-12-271-2/+4
| | | | Signed-off-by: Hans de Graaff <graaff@gentoo.org>